Output 3ad5206b8ada71b6b51a4fe9a66526c350f526a5948845cf3f54b9d3f366b8c1:3

value
7817309
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a784a166890886eaef51892af15ac42985ff642 OP_EQUAL
address
32eNnKJdCcAwjUMszTGviHaCqBqf6r6mV3
transaction
3ad5206b8ada71b6b51a4fe9a66526c350f526a5948845cf3f54b9d3f366b8c1
confirmations
329715
spent
true